Skip to content

Commit 85bb696

Browse files
authored
Merge pull request #20250 from mozilla/fxa-13276
fix(settings): dont send duplicate otp codes
2 parents 1c78b52 + be242ba commit 85bb696

1 file changed

Lines changed: 4 additions & 2 deletions

File tree

  • packages/fxa-settings/src/pages/Signin/SigninPasswordlessCode

packages/fxa-settings/src/pages/Signin/SigninPasswordlessCode/container.tsx

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-83,7 +83,9 @@ const SigninPasswordlessCodeContainer = ({
8383
};
8484
sendCode();
8585
}
86-
}, [email, service, codeSent, authClient, integration, navigateWithQuery, location.pathname, location.search, location.state, flowQueryParams]);
86+
// Only run this on initial render
87+
// eslint-disable-next-line react-hooks/exhaustive-deps
88+
}, []);
8789

8890
if (!email) {
8991
return (
@@ -132,4 +134,4 @@ const SigninPasswordlessCodeContainer = ({
132134
);
133135
};
134136

135-
export default SigninPasswordlessCodeContainer;
137+
export default SigninPasswordlessCodeContainer;

0 commit comments

Comments
 (0)